This week the ladies of Moms Night Out are joined by child and adolescent psychologist and instructor at Harvard Medical School, Dr. Ellie Richards. The ladies do a deep dive with Dr. Richards about "Gentle Parenting". 
We are constantly being told how we should parent and what style is best.  It can feel like advice overload with social media channels such as tiktok and instagram. 
Are there consequences for over-protecting our children?  If we don’t give them the opportunity to get hurt, resolve conflict on their own and feel uncomfortable, will they learn how to be resilient? 
Join Jenny, Katie, Mandy as they chat Gentle Parenting with Dr. Richards, who provides easy take aways for how to connect with our children.
